Code Archive Skip to content Google About Google Privacy Terms
ランディ・パウシュ教授の最終講義 2008-04-01-1 [English] 昨年の秋頃に公開されたカーネギーメロン大学の ランディ・パウシュ教授 (http://www.cs.cmu.edu/~pausch/) の 「最後の講義 (The Last Lecture)」という動画が人気だそうです。 どんな内容かと言うと、ええと、下記をご覧ください。 - Clue's pick-up: ガンに侵されたRandy Pausch教授の最後の講義 http://www.clue-web.net/blog/2007/09/randy_pausch.php 3Dアニメーション作成システム「Alice」を開発したカーネギーメロン大学 コンピューターサイエンス学部のランディー・パウシュ教授は、膵臓癌で 余命は何ヶ月もないと宣告されている状態。そんな彼の、子供の頃にラン ディ少年が抱いていた夢をベースにし
Amazon EC2はごく手軽に使える仮想サーバだが、その性質上、サーバ(インスタンス)を終了すると全てのデータが消失するようになっている。これではデータを保存するようなことができない。そこで使われるのがAmazon S3というストレージサービスだ。 s3fsのプロジェクトページ 各種ライブラリは存在するが、最も使い勝手の良い方法はこれだろう。ファイルシステム並みに使うのだ。 今回紹介するオープンソース・ソフトウェアはs3fs、Amazon S3向けのFUSEだ。 FUSEを使うことで、通常のファイルシステムと同じ感覚でAmazon S3が利用できるようになる。インスタンスを落とすことで消失すると困るデータはs3fsを使ってマウントしたファイルシステムに入れるか、定期的なバッチでコピーしたりすれば良い。 利用はターミナルベース。オプションでアクセスIDを指定するか、/etc/passwd-
twitterのネットワークをグラフにして書き出してみる。python-twitterとnetworkxを使用。日本語のフォントの指定の仕方(pylabのほうだと思う)がわからなかったので日本語は表示されていない。 from pylab import * from networkx import * import twitter myname= USERNAME mypassword = PASSWORD api = twitter.Api(username=myname,password=mypassword) friends = api.GetFriends() G = XGraph() for friend in friends: G.add_edge(myname,friend.name) for friend in friends[-3:]: for user in api.Ge
Pythonから「gdata-python-client」を使用してGoogleSpreadsheetの値を更新することができます。簡単なサンプルを作成いたしましたので下記に掲載します。 ※プログラムに定義されている変数に適切な値を設定してください。 _username: GoogleAccountのメールを設定します。 _password: GoogleAccountのパスワードを設定します。 _key: GoogleSpreadsheetにアクセスした際のURLに表示される「key」の値を設定します。 #!/usr/bin/env python # -*- coding: utf-8 -*- import sys import codecs import gdata.spreadsheet.service sys.stdout = codecs.getwriter('cp932')(s
PythonでHTMLを解析してHTMLのタグをいろいろ操作する必要があり、調べてみると「BeautifulSoup」という便利なモジュールがありました。 ・BeautifulSoup 早速使ってみましたが、これはすごく良いですね。簡単にHTMLを解析して操作することができました。しかも、HTMLだけではなくXMLにも使えるようです。 EasyInstallに対応しているので、下記のコマンドで簡単にインストールすることができました。 easy_install beautifulsoup 下記に簡単なサンプルを掲載します。 ■HTML内の特定のタグを取得 #!/usr/bin/env python # -*- coding: utf-8 -*- from BeautifulSoup import BeautifulSoup from BeautifulSoup import Tag html
僕はネコ型ロボットで、そのとき野比家の屋根の上に座っていた。 十一月の冷ややかな雨が大地を暗く染め、傘をさした小学生たちや、 閑散とした裏山の上に立った杉の木や、明日ののびたの宿題やそんな何もかもを フランドル派の陰うつな絵の背景のように見せていた。 やれやれ、またのびたの世話か、と僕は思った。 「完璧なネコ型ロボットなどといったものは存在しない。完璧な人間が存在しないようにね。」 僕に耳があったころ偶然にも知り合った未来デパートのの店員は僕に向ってそう言った。 僕がその本当の意味を理解できたのはのびたの子守になってからのことだったが、 少くともそれをある種の慰めとしてとることも可能であった。 完璧なネコ型ロボットなんて存在しない、と。 「じゃあ私たちわかりあえるわね?」と静ちゃんは静かに言った。 彼女が電話の向こうで椅子にゆったりと座りなおし、脚を組んだような雰囲気
Each year, the Pulitzer Prize award is given to those in newspaper, magazine, online journalism, literature, and musical composition for their achievements. This year, for 2024, amongst the 45 journalists who have been selected as finalists, five people’s entries are AI-powered. While the extent of the use of artificial intelligence in their submissions isn’t yet…
Data visualization and infographics resources for design inspiration 6 comments Infographics or Information graphics is mode of visual communication of information using graphics. Like maps, technical writing, flowcharts, scientific visualization, process visualization etc. They can be very good resources of inspiration for various design jobs as they solve communication problems using easy to und
NOTCOT Note: Here is another post continuing on Justine’s (aka RUGenius’) adventures in Sheffield, it took a bit of researching, but she’s come back to me with some MIND BLOWING infographics from Stephanie Posavec, you definitely need to click on the images after the jump to see them in full resolution where you can see what every curve and color represents. I kid you not, you will not see Kerouac
※あくまで試験的に公開しています まぁありきたりというか、なんというかなんですけどニコニコ動画の自分用ライブラリを以前から作っていました。公開してもよかったんですけど、需要があるかわかんないし、まとまってないですし、ニコニコ動画的にもこういうライブラリをつかってごにゃごにゃするのはちょっと・・・という感じらしいので公開してませんでした。 なんですけど、公開されてるライブラリもありますし、せっかくなんで試験的に公開しておけばなんかの役に立つかな、と思いまして。使ってくれる人が多かったりすれば、まとめなおしてCodeReposに突っ込むかもしれません。 ダウンロードしてみる奇特な方はどうぞ nicovideo.zip 必要なもの 1easy_install mechanize 2easy_install lxml 使い方 1import nicovideo as n 2client = n.N
If you're on the hunt for the perfect baby name for the latest addition to your family, look no further. We've got every baby name under the sun with meanings, popularity, pop culture references and more. Whether you're searching for a vintage name, a superhero-inspired name or one steeped in history, we've got you covered. If you're on the hunt for the perfect baby name for the latest addition to
はじめに 本稿ではRubyを使ってシンプルなPOP3サーバを作成します。 POP3は、いわゆる「メールの受信」のときに使われるプロトコル(通信規約)です。本稿では、このPOP3でサービスを提供するサーバの作成を通じて、以下のことを学びます。ネットワークプログラミングの基礎POP3の仕組みRubyによるネットワークプログラミングRubyによるUNIXシステムプログラミング POPdの概要 本稿で作成するPOP3サーバ(POPd)は、イントラネットなどの信頼できるネットワークを前提として作成します。そのため、セキュリティへの配慮は最低限にとどめ、できるだけシンプルな構造を心掛けます。ただし「最低限の配慮」として、パスワードが平文で流れないようにするため、POP3の中でも特にAPOPという認証方法を用います。 また、速度やメモリ容量に関してもあまり配慮しません。せいぜい数人から数十人が日常的に使
世界で最も幸せなプログラムは、プログラムを書くプログラムである 30分プログラム、その110。バイナリデータのパーサを自動生成してみる。 id:mzp:20070816:classfileがほとんど手書きで書けそうだったので。 使い方 $ cat classfile.h ClassFile{ u4 magic; u2 minor_version; u2 major_version; u2 constant_pool_count; } $ mkparser classfile.h > classfile.hs $ ghc --make runner $ runner Test.class magic: -889275714 0xcafebabe minor_version: 0 0x0 major_version: 49 0x31 constant_pool_count: 34 0x22ヘッ
ちょっと前にラジオで聴いた、某有名アーティストの「今でも後悔している昔の彼女の話」を思い出したので。 僕の記憶の範囲で再現し、まとめているので、たぶんディテールはけっこう違うはずです。なので、誰の話かも書きません。 若いころ、僕は地元でライブとかやってて、自分で言うのもなんですけど、まあ、けっこう人気あったんですよね。小さなライブハウスだったけど、立見のお客さんがいたりして。 当時付き合ってた女の子、彼女はそんなに派手な感じじゃないんだけど、とにかくしっかり者で、地元にも友達が多くって。 それで、あの頃、彼女は僕のライブのチケットをたくさん友達に売ってくれてたんですよね。 僕もそういうのにすっかり慣れちゃってて、それは自分の人気のおかげなんだと思ってた。 ある時、地元の友達に言われたんですよ。 「お前の彼女、なんかお金に困ってるみたいだぞ」って。 ブランド物を買い漁ったりする子じゃなかった
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く